区块链哈希值竞猜源码,技术解析与应用探索区块链哈希值竞猜源码
嗯,用户给了一段关于区块链哈希值竞猜源码的技术解析与应用探索的文章,然后让我帮忙修正错别字、修饰语句,补充内容,尽量做到原创,我需要仔细阅读原文,理解其结构和内容。 原文主要分为几个部分:哈希函数的基本原理、在区块链中的应用、哈希值竞猜源码的开发与实现,以及安全性分析,看起来结构清晰,但可能有些地方表达不够流畅,或者有错别字。 我需要检查是否有错别字。“源码”可能应该用“代码”或者“源代码”?或者“哈希值竞猜”是否正确?还有“哈希函数”是否应该用“哈希算法”?这些可能需要根据上下文调整。 考虑如何修饰语句,让文章更流畅,原文中的“核心特性”可以改为“核心特性包括”,这样更正式一些,还有“抗碰撞性”可能拼写错误,应该是“抗碰撞性”。 方面,可能需要添加一些技术细节,比如具体的哈希函数实现方式,或者竞猜模型的具体算法,比如LSTM的具体应用,可以加入一些应用场景的扩展,比如在供应链管理中的具体例子,或者在智能合约中的实际应用案例。 原文的结构可能需要调整,比如在“开发与实现”部分,可以更详细地描述每个步骤,比如数据清洗的具体方法,或者模型训练的具体模型选择,这样可以让读者更清楚流程。 安全性分析部分,可能需要更详细地解释每个抗性,比如抗碰撞性的具体实现方式,或者抗量子攻击的哈希函数选择,这样可以让分析更有深度。 确保整个文章逻辑连贯,每个部分之间有自然的过渡,避免重复或遗漏,可能需要添加一些总结性的段落,强调哈希值竞猜源码的重要性,或者未来的发展方向。 我需要逐段分析原文,修正错别字,优化表达,补充技术细节,确保内容原创且结构合理,这样用户的需求就能得到满足,文章也会更加专业和易读。
区块链哈希值竞猜源码,
本文目录导读:
随着区块链技术的快速发展,哈希函数在区块链中的应用越来越广泛,哈希值作为区块链中的核心组件,扮演着不可替代的角色,本文将深入探讨哈希值在区块链中的意义,以及基于哈希值的竞猜源码开发与应用。
哈希函数的基本原理
哈希函数是一种将任意长度的输入数据映射到固定长度的输出值的数学函数,其核心特性包括:
- 确定性:相同的输入数据始终生成相同的哈希值。
- 不可逆性:已知哈希值无法推导出原始输入数据。
- 均匀分布:哈希值在给定范围内均匀分布,减少碰撞概率。
- 抗碰撞性:不同输入数据产生相同哈希值的概率极低。
哈希函数在密码学领域具有重要地位,广泛应用于数据完整性验证、身份验证等领域。
哈希函数在区块链中的应用
区块链技术的核心是分布式账本和共识机制,哈希函数在区块链中扮演着关键角色,主要体现在以下几个方面:
- 数据完整性验证:哈希值可以用来验证交易数据的完整性,通过比较区块哈希值,可以快速判断数据是否被篡改。
- 不可篡改性:由于哈希函数的不可逆性,区块数据一旦被篡改,其哈希值也会发生变化,从而被检测到。
- 共识机制:哈希函数用于生成区块哈希值,作为共识机制的核心依据,节点通过计算哈希值,选择具有最小哈希值的区块加入链中,实现共识。
- 去中心化存储:哈希函数用于数据存储和验证,通过哈希值可以快速验证数据的完整性和真实性,实现高效的去中心化存储。
哈希值竞猜源码的开发与实现
哈希值竞猜是一种基于哈希函数的预测性分析技术,其基本思路是通过分析历史哈希值,预测未来哈希值的变化趋势,竞猜源码的开发需要综合考虑算法设计、数据处理、性能优化等多个方面。
算法设计
哈希值竞猜的核心是选择合适的哈希函数,常见的哈希函数包括:
- SHA-256:一种常用的哈希函数,广泛应用于比特币等区块链项目。
- RIPEMD-160:一种160位哈希函数,常用于数字签名和数据完整性验证。
- BLAKE2:一种快速哈希函数,支持多种哈希长度。
根据具体应用场景,选择合适的哈希函数是算法设计的关键。
数据处理
哈希值竞猜需要对历史哈希值进行分析,数据来源可以是公开的区块链哈希值数据,也可以是模拟生成的数据,数据预处理包括:
- 数据清洗:去除无效数据和噪声数据。
- 数据归一化:将不同规模的哈希值进行归一化处理,便于分析。
- 特征提取:提取哈希值的分布特征,如均值、方差等。
模型训练
基于历史哈希值数据,训练预测模型,常用的方法包括:
- 回归分析:通过回归模型预测哈希值的变化趋势。
- 时间序列分析:利用时间序列模型,如ARIMA,分析哈希值的时间序列特性。
- 机器学习模型:利用深度学习模型,如LSTM,对哈希值进行预测。
模型训练需要考虑数据的时序性、非线性特性,以及模型的泛化能力。
性能优化
哈希值竞猜源码的性能优化主要体现在计算效率和预测精度上,优化方法包括:
- 并行计算:利用多核处理器或GPU加速哈希值的计算。
- 算法优化:通过优化哈希函数的实现,提高计算速度。
- 模型优化:通过调整模型参数,提高预测精度。
应用场景
哈希值竞猜源码可以应用于多个领域,包括:
- 金融领域:用于预测加密货币价格走势。
- 供应链管理:用于实时监控产品溯源信息。
- 智能合约:用于预测智能合约的执行结果。
哈希值竞猜源码的安全性分析
哈希值竞猜源码的安全性是其应用的重要保障,需要从以下几个方面进行安全性分析:
- 抗碰撞性:确保哈希函数具有良好的抗碰撞性,防止不同输入数据产生相同哈希值。
- 抗预判性:确保哈希函数的输出不可预测,防止对手提前预测哈希值。
- 抗干扰性:确保哈希函数在面对外部干扰时,仍能保持稳定运行。
- 抗量子攻击:考虑未来量子计算机的威胁,选择抗量子攻击的哈希函数。
哈希值竞猜源码是区块链技术的重要应用之一,通过合理选择哈希函数、优化算法设计、提高模型性能,可以实现高效的哈希值预测,需要注意哈希值竞猜源码的安全性,确保其在实际应用中的稳定性和可靠性,随着哈希函数技术的不断进步,哈希值竞猜源码的应用前景将更加广阔。
发表评论